The document is titled Defendant's Second Supplemental Responses to Plaintiff's First Set of Interrogatories and serves as a formal filing in a legal case. It allows the defendant to provide additional information in response to the plaintiff's interrogatories, which are a series of written questions. Key features of this supplementary form include the ability to restate objections while providing answers, the ongoing nature of discovery, and spaces for filling in specific details.
